GLORIOUS VICTORY Short Film – AUDIENCE FEEDBACK from the Dec. 2017 Experimental Film Festival
GLORIOUS VICTORY, 2min., USA, Animation Directed by Will Kim Glorious Victory is an animated short film about two beetles fighting over a fig fruit which leads both of the beetles to complete disaster. Watch Music Video Film: 100% – Lost Youth
Lost Youth was the debut single from the 12” release “You are 100%” via Moontown Records. Shoot was between 2 cameras to created a hall of mirrors effect in a washed colour glow across the band members.
